Commercial Parking Lot Sealing in Sarasota, FL
Commercial parking lot s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face of asphalt or concrete parking areas to prevent damage from weather, moisture, and everyday wear.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including large parking lots for retail centers, office complexes, or residential communities. Property owners typically seek parking lot sealing to extend the lifespan of their pavement, improve curb appeal, and reduce the need for costly repairs over time.
Before requesting parking lot sealing, property owners should consider the current condition of the surface, including existing cracks, potholes, or signs of deterioration. Proper cleaning and preparation are essential for effective sealing, so understanding the scope of the project and any necessary repairs can help ensure a successful application. Consulting with a professional can provide insights into the best sealing products and techniques suited to the specific needs of the parking area.

Commercial Parking Lot Sealing Questions
What is parking lot sealing? Parking lot sealing involves applying a protective coating to asphalt surfaces to prevent damage from weather, UV rays, and vehicle traffic.
Why should property owners consider sealing a parking lot?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the asphalt, reduces cracking, and maintains a clean, professional appearance.
What types of parking lots benefit most from sealing? Both commercial and residential parking lots with asphalt surfaces can benefit from sealing to protect against wear and tear.
When is the best time to seal a parking lot? The ideal time is during warm, dry weather to ensure proper adhesion and curing of the sealant.
